Live LLM-thinking stream, fix resolver garbage names, safer rules (v1.12.95)
The LLM Reading card splits into thinking-stream (left) and passage (right), fed by a new SSE endpoint that shares prompt-building and parsing with the blocking one and falls back to it on any stream failure (inactivity timeout, not overall). The deterministic resolver no longer invents speakers from scenery nouns (PLATZ/GESICHTER/ KLEINIGKEIT) — person-noun whitelist plus a clause-subject pattern — and gains the impersonal post-quote formula and strict two-person alternation with colon/page/window guards. All reported failure cases verified against the exact book sentences. Co-Authored-By: Claude Fable 5 <noreply@anthropic.com>

## [1.12.95] — 2026-07-05
|
||||||
|
|
||||||
|
### Added
|
||||||
|
- **Watch the LLM think, live** — the "LLM Reading…" card now splits into two panes the moment the model starts responding: its raw output stream (reasoning + the answer JSON as it's written) on the left, the passage it's reading on the right. Backed by a new streaming endpoint (`/api/attribute-dialogue/stream`, SSE) that forwards both `reasoning_content` (thinking models) and `content` deltas; the prompt-building and answer-parsing are shared with the blocking endpoint so the two can never drift. Any stream failure falls back to the blocking endpoint automatically — with an inactivity timeout (reset on every received chunk) instead of an overall one, since a slow model legitimately takes minutes per passage but long silence means the stream died. Works in the main cast, Recast unknown, and 2nd Quality Run.
|
||||||
|
|
||||||
|
### Fixed
|
||||||
|
- **Resolver invented characters from scenery words** — the deterministic colon-rule's fallback accepted any "der/die + capitalized noun", turning "auf dem Platz", "die Gesichter", "eine Kleinigkeit" into speakers PLATZ/GESICHTER/KLEINIGKEIT. The fallback is now a closed whitelist of person/role nouns, plus a clause-subject pattern ("Marcian unterdrückte seinen Ärger und sagte:" → Marcian).
|
||||||
|
- **More Unknowns resolved, safely** — two new deterministic rules: the impersonal post-quote formula ("ertönte es plötzlich über ihm. Karyla hatte…" → Karyla), and strict two-person alternation (both nearest preceding dialogue lines named and different → the one who didn't just speak), guarded to never fire across page boundaries, beyond a short window, or when the preceding narration ends with ":" (that colon introduces someone the other rules couldn't name — alternation would be a guess, not a deduction). All screenshot failure cases verified against the exact book sentences.
